Association Between Neutrophil Percentage-to-Albumin Ratio and Neutrophil-to-Albumin Ratio with Long-Term Mortality in Patients with Intracerebral Hemorrhage

作者:Sen Zhang, Yangchun Xiao, Xiang Yuan, Quanhu Guo, Yuyang Liu, Jun Wan, Peng Wang, Cuyubamba Dominguez Jorge Luis, Shijie Fan, Hao Liu, Yikang Ouyang, Qi Sheng You, Fang Fang, Yu Zhang · 发表于:World Neurosurgery · 年份:2025 · DOI:10.1016/j.wneu.2025.124279 · 被引用次数:4 · 研究领域:Intracerebral and Subarachnoid Hemorrhage Research、Inflammatory Biomarkers in Disease Prognosis、Acute Ischemic Stroke Management

BACKGROUND: The association between the neutrophil percentage-to-albumin ratio (NPAR) and neutrophil-to-albumin ratio (NAR) with long-term mortality in patients with intracerebral hemorrhage (ICH) remains underexplored. METHODS: We conducted a retrospective cohort study, including patients diagnosed with ICH from 2 tertiary care centers. NPAR and NAR levels were calculated from blood samples obtained within 24 hours of admission. The primary outcome was long-term mortality, defined as mortality at the longest available follow-up. Univariate and multivariate Cox proportional hazard models were used to assess the associations. To demonstrate the predictive performance of different biomarkers over time, time-dependent receiver operating characteristic curve analysis was created. RESULTS: A total of 3350 patients with ICH were included in this study. Higher quartiles of the NPAR and NAR were associated with increased long-term mortality. Multivariate Cox regression analysis revealed that patients in the highest quartile of NPAR and NAR had substantially higher mortality risks compared to those in the lowest quartile (NPAR Q4 vs. Q1: adjusted hazard ratio: 2.15, 95% confidence interval: 1.78-2.59; NAR Q4 vs. Q1: adjusted hazard ratio: 1.82, 95% confidence interval: 1.52-2.18). Similar associations were observed for in-hospital mortality, 1-year mortality, and long-term mortality among discharge and 1-year survivors.
